/[packages]/cauldron/libtermcap/current/SPECS/libtermcap.spec
ViewVC logotype

Diff of /cauldron/libtermcap/current/SPECS/libtermcap.spec

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 273157 by blino, Fri Jun 1 21:05:42 2012 UTC revision 273158 by colin, Sat Jul 21 17:42:31 2012 UTC
# Line 9  Line 9 
9  Summary:        A basic system library for accessing the termcap database  Summary:        A basic system library for accessing the termcap database
10  Name:           %{name}  Name:           %{name}
11  Version:        %{version}  Version:        %{version}
12  Release:        %mkrel 51  Release:        %mkrel 52
13  Source:         termcap-%{version}.tar.bz2  Source:         termcap-%{version}.tar.bz2
14  Url:            ftp://metalab.unc.edu/pub/Linux/GCC/  Url:            ftp://metalab.unc.edu/pub/Linux/GCC/
15  License:        LGPL+  License:        LGPL+
# Line 46  a terminal-independent manner. Line 46  a terminal-independent manner.
46  Summary:        Development tools for programs which will access the termcap database  Summary:        Development tools for programs which will access the termcap database
47  Group:          System/Libraries  Group:          System/Libraries
48  Obsoletes:      %{libname_orig}  Obsoletes:      %{libname_orig}
49    Requires(pre):  filesystem >= 2.1.9-18
50  Provides:       %{libname_orig}  Provides:       %{libname_orig}
51    
52  %description -n %{libname}  %description -n %{libname}
# Line 60  Group:         Development/C Line 61  Group:         Development/C
61  Requires:       %{libname} = %version  Requires:       %{libname} = %version
62  Provides:       %{libname_orig}-devel = %{version}-%{release}  Provides:       %{libname_orig}-devel = %{version}-%{release}
63  Provides:       termcap-devel = %{version}-%{release}  Provides:       termcap-devel = %{version}-%{release}
64    Requires(pre):  filesystem >= 2.1.9-18
65  Requires(post): info-install  Requires(post): info-install
66  Requires(preun):        info-install  Requires(preun):        info-install
67    
# Line 94  libtermcap package. Line 96  libtermcap package.
96  rm -rf %{buildroot}  rm -rf %{buildroot}
97  # (gb) They should do proper Makefiles  # (gb) They should do proper Makefiles
98    
 mkdir -p %{buildroot}/%{_lib}  
 install -m 755 libtermcap.so.* %{buildroot}/%{_lib}/  
 ln -s libtermcap.so.2.0.8 %{buildroot}/%{_lib}/libtermcap.so  
 ln -s libtermcap.so.2.0.8 %{buildroot}/%{_lib}/libtermcap.so.2  
   
99  mkdir -p %{buildroot}%{_libdir}  mkdir -p %{buildroot}%{_libdir}
100  install -m 644 libtermcap.a %{buildroot}%{_libdir}/  install -m 644 libtermcap.a %{buildroot}%{_libdir}/
101  ln -s ../../%{_lib}/libtermcap.so.2.0.8 %{buildroot}%{_libdir}/libtermcap.so  install -m 755 libtermcap.so.* %{buildroot}%{_libdir}/
102    ln -s libtermcap.so.2.0.8 %{buildroot}%{_libdir}/libtermcap.so
103    ln -s libtermcap.so.2.0.8 %{buildroot}%{_libdir}/libtermcap.so.2
104    
105  mkdir -p %{buildroot}%{_infodir}  mkdir -p %{buildroot}%{_infodir}
106  install -m 644 termcap.info* %{buildroot}%{_infodir}/  install -m 644 termcap.info* %{buildroot}%{_infodir}/
# Line 128  fi Line 127  fi
127    
128  %files -n %{libname}  %files -n %{libname}
129  %defattr(-,root,root)  %defattr(-,root,root)
130  /%{_lib}/*.so.*  %{_libdir}/*.so.*
131    
132  %files -n %{develname}  %files -n %{develname}
133  %defattr(-,root,root)  %defattr(-,root,root)
134  %doc ChangeLog README  %doc ChangeLog README
 /%{_lib}/*.so  
135  %{_infodir}/termcap.info*  %{_infodir}/termcap.info*
136  %{_libdir}/libtermcap.a  %{_libdir}/libtermcap.a
137  %{_libdir}/libtermcap.so  %{_libdir}/libtermcap.so

Legend:
Removed from v.273157  
changed lines
  Added in v.273158

  ViewVC Help
Powered by ViewVC 1.1.30